In this powerful final installment of our Wine Culture Awareness Series, I'm pulling back the curtain on how alcohol has subtly infiltrated our lives, disguised as self-care and freedom. This episode is for anyone who's questioning their relationship with drinking - whether you're still consuming alcohol or already alcohol-free.
Key Insights:
You are not broken - you've been conditioned to cope with challenges in unhealthy ways
Alcohol often becomes a mechanism to numb emotional pain, trauma, and stress
Cultural messaging has normalized drinking as a solution to life's difficulties

Challenging Your Beliefs:
Investigate the origin of their drinking habits
Question beliefs like "wine relaxes me" or "I'm more fun when drinking"
Recognize that alcohol often creates numbness, not genuine relaxation
